About Premier Inn Lewes Town Centre

From the A27 take the Lewes, East Grinstead, Tunbridge Wells exit onto the A26 at the Southerham Roundabout. Go through the Cuilfail Tunnel and take the first exit left at the roundabout after the tunnel onto Malling Street/A2029. Continue over next roundabout onto Phoenix Causeway and at the traffic lights continue onto Friars Walk B2193. The hotel will be on the left hand side. Premier Inn Lewes Town Centre is in the middle of the tranquil town of Lewes, East Sussex. Surrounded by rolling countryside and white chalk cliffs, it's a picturesque hiking pit-stop. While you're in town, head to nearby Firle Beacon for a bird's eye view of the South Downs, explore the ruins of 1000 year old Lewes Castle or sample traditional cask ale at the historic Harvey's Brewery. Plus, if you visit around bonfire night, you're in for a treat - Lewes locals celebrate in style, and it's the biggest 5th November event in the world. When it's time for a bite to eat, take your pick from the delicious menu at our in-house Thyme restaurant and then drift off for a great night's sleep in your stylish bedroom with toasty duvet and ultra-comfy kingsize Hypnos bed.

Reviews summary

This AI-generated summary was based on reviews from multiple 
sites

The hotel stands out for its central location in the heart of Lewes, offering guests easy access to local attractions and transport links. Its signature feature is the consistently praised comfortable beds and clean rooms, ensuring a restful stay for most visitors. The excellent breakfast service also receives widespread acclaim, contributing significantly to guest satisfaction. This establishment is particularly well-suited for sightseers and families looking to explore the town, as well as business travelers seeking a convenient and quiet base. Couples also find it ideal for a relaxing getaway. To enhance your experience, it is advisable to be aware of the local parking arrangements, which can be restrictive, and consider requesting a room away from high-traffic areas for maximum tranquility.


Facilities & Amenities
Guests frequently comment on the hotel's facilities, though feedback is mixed regarding some aspects. Most rooms are equipped with a kettle, tea and coffee supplies, and a hairdryer, with Premier Plus rooms offering additional amenities like a fridge and mini Nespresso machine. While Wi-Fi is available, many guests report it to be slow or patchy, making streaming difficult. Some also noted issues with charging points not working. The hotel provides lift access to all floors, which is appreciated. However, a common point of contention is the lack of opening windows in rooms, which some guests find restrictive. Additionally, some rooms were found to have only a single set of towels for double occupancy, and the quality of shampoo and other toiletries was occasionally deemed inferior to other similar hotels.


Cleanliness & Room Comfort
The hotel generally receives high praise for its cleanliness and the comfort of its rooms. Guests consistently highlight the very clean condition of the accommodations and the comfortable beds, which contribute to a good night's sleep. Many rooms are described as spacious, particularly family rooms, and feature well-laid out designs and good temperature control. The bathrooms are often noted as clean and well-maintained, with hot water readily available. However, a significant number of guests report noise issues, ranging from street noise and footsteps from above to disturbances from the reception area or main entrance, due to thin walls and ceilings. Some rooms were also perceived as "tired," and isolated incidents included a funny smell, a loose shower curtain rail, or a non-functional extractor fan.


Dining & Food Quality
The hotel's breakfast service is a major highlight for most guests, frequently described as excellent and delicious. Many appreciate that the hot food is cooked to order, ensuring freshness and quality, rather than a buffet style. The breakfast variety is also commended, including real juices, a good selection of continental items, and premium ingredients like sausages and various egg preparations. While the overall food quality is high, some isolated negative experiences were reported, such as bacon being overcooked or cold, or a single instance of feeling unwell after breakfast. Feedback on the evening meal is more mixed; while some found it very nice, others noted an unhealthy menu, inadequate service, or issues with food temperature. There were also concerns about a chef's hygiene standards in one instance.


Location & Accessibility
The hotel's central location in Lewes is consistently lauded as a significant advantage, placing guests within easy walking distance of the town's shops, restaurants, and attractions like Harvey's Brewery and Lewes Castle. Its proximity to the train station also makes it convenient for exploring the wider area, including trips to Glyndebourne. However, parking is a recurring challenge for many visitors. The adjacent council-run car park has limited spaces and strict time restrictions during the day, often requiring guests to move their vehicles or seek alternative, sometimes distant, parking. The presence of a farmers market in the car park on Saturdays further complicates parking arrangements, causing inconvenience for some.


Staff & Service
The staff at the hotel receive overwhelmingly positive feedback, frequently described as friendly, helpful, and welcoming. Many guests highlight their attentiveness and willingness to go above and beyond to assist with requests, contributing to a pleasant stay. The check-in process is generally smooth and efficient, though some guests experienced issues with early check-in requests or key card malfunctions. While the majority of interactions are positive, a few isolated reviews mentioned instances of unhelpful or rude staff, particularly concerning parking information or room change requests. Despite these few exceptions, the overall consensus is that the team provides excellent service, with many individuals being singled out for their exceptional care and professionalism.


Additional Information
Guests should be aware of certain operational aspects that impact their stay. The hotel has a strict early check-in policy, often requiring a fee even for arrivals just before the official check-in time, which some guests found frustrating. While most rooms are standard, Premier Plus rooms offer enhanced features like improved lighting and additional in-room amenities. The hotel's location above several restaurants means that during warmer months, noise from open windows and patrons can be an issue. The adjacent farmers market on Saturdays also affects parking availability and requires vehicle relocation. For wheelchair users, it is crucial to specifically book an accessible room, as standard rooms may not accommodate mobility needs, particularly regarding bathroom access.
